DIMETHICONE PEG-8 LANOLATE.

Avoid / HAIR CONDITIONING, SKIN CONDITIONING, SKIN CONDITIONING - EMOLLIENT

DIMETHICONE PEG-8 LANOLATE is a silicone-derived polymer that functions as a conditioning agent. It forms a protective barrier on the skin's surface, aiding in moisture retention and contributing to a smooth, lubricious feel.

Science

Upon application, DIMETHICONE PEG-8 LANOLATE creates a hydrophobic film over the stratum corneum. This physical barrier prevents external irritants from penetrating the skin and significantly reduces transepidermal water loss, thereby enhancing skin hydration. The film also imparts noticeable shine and slipperiness to the skin, contributing to an improved tactile sensation.

The Cosmetic Ingredient Review (CIR) has not yet evaluated DIMETHICONE PEG-8 LANOLATE. The Environmental Working Group (EWG) has highlighted several serious concerns, labeling it as environmentally persistent and not anaerobically degradable. Furthermore, based on EU GHS Hazard Labeling Codes and California Proposition 65, there are indications of suspected damage to fertility, clear evidence of endocrine disruption in animal studies, and suspicion of causing genetic defects or cancer. Consequently, EWG VERIFIED products are restricted from including this ingredient without comprehensive substantiation. While Dimethicone, its base component, is recognized by the US FDA as a skin protectant at low concentrations and is generally deemed safe in cosmetic products when formulated to be non-irritating due to its high molecular weight and limited skin absorption, the PEG-8 LANOLATE modification introduces significant additional concerns that necessitate extreme caution, particularly regarding reproductive and endocrine health.
